Hundreds of Laravel applications are now at risk after cybersecurity researchers uncovered a massive leak of APP_KEYs on GitHub. The discovery has triggered alarm across the developer community and exposed a major security crisis.
APP_KEYs are crucial for encrypting sensitive data in Laravel apps. When leaked, attackers can exploit these keys to gain remote code execution, putting user data and business infrastructure in jeopardy.
How did so many Laravel APP_KEYs end up exposed on GitHub?
Researchers from GitGuardian and Synacktiv found more than 260,000 APP_KEYs leaked on GitHub repositories since 2018. Over 600 live applications were confirmed vulnerable, with 400 APP_KEYs validated as functional.
The majority of these exposures came from .env files, which often contain not just APP_KEYs but other sensitive information like database credentials and cloud storage tokens. Developers frequently commit these files by mistake, making them publicly accessible.
Did you know?
More than 260,000 Laravel APP_KEYs have been leaked on GitHub since 2018, with over 600 apps confirmed vulnerable to remote code execution attacks.
What makes the APP_KEY leak so dangerous for businesses?
Laravel’s decrypt() function automatically deserializes decrypted data. If an attacker obtains a valid APP_KEY, they can craft malicious payloads that trigger remote code execution on the server. This means attackers can run arbitrary commands, steal data, and compromise entire systems.
Leaking both APP_KEYs and APP_URLs increases the risk. With both, attackers can directly target the application, retrieve session cookies, and attempt to decrypt them, potentially hijacking user sessions or escalating access.
ALSO READ | 2025 Data Risk Report Reveals Billions of Sensitive Records at Risk from AI Tools
APP_KEY leaks are fueling a new wave of cyberattacks
Researchers have already observed threat actors exploiting these leaks in the wild, including malware groups like AndroxGh0st. Attackers scan the internet for Laravel apps with exposed APP_KEYs, then use automated tools to break into vulnerable systems.
Other secrets, like payment platform credentials or AI service tokens, sometimes accompany APP_KEY leaks. This allows attackers to expand their scope and target additional infrastructure and sensitive customer data.
Developers face urgent pressure to secure Laravel secrets
Security experts warn that simply deleting exposed APP_KEYs from repositories is not enough. Once a key is leaked, it must be rotated immediately, and all production systems updated. Continuous secret monitoring and automated scanning are now considered best practices.
The crisis highlights the need for better developer education, stronger security tooling, and a culture of vigilance around secret management. As attackers grow more sophisticated, organizations must act quickly to lock down their Laravel applications and prevent further breaches.
With the scale and impact of these leaks still unfolding, the developer community faces a critical test. Proactive security measures today will determine whether tomorrow’s applications remain safe from this growing threat.
Comments (0)
Please sign in to leave a comment
No comments yet. Be the first to share your thoughts!